THE JOURNEYS OF ABRAHAM - The Rand-McNally Bible Atlas
After the destruction of the cities of the plain, Abraham moved southward, and made his home at Beersheba, on the desert border, now Bir es Seba. Here he spent most of his later years, as after various journeys we find him each time encamped at Beersheba.
Map of Abram’s Journey to the Promised Land
Follow Abram: 1. Abram traveled from Ur to Haran with his father Terah and settled there (Genesis 11:31). 2. God called Abram from Haran to Canaan (Genesis 12:1). 3. Abram arrived in the land, heard from the Lord at Shechem and worshipped at Bethel (Genesis 12:6-8).
The Journey and Events of Abraham - Bible Portal
Nov 3, 2022 · 1. From Ur to Haran. (Gen. 11:27-32) The family of Abraham (then called Abram) lived at Ur of the Chaldees, probably Mugheir, south of the Euphrates, and an early seat of empire.
